    whole house TTS announcements with Sonos?

    So i picked up a couple of play-1's today. I was hoping to use these for getting TTS announcements across whole house zones. Do i need a line in capable sonos device to hook into the HS3 pc to source the TTS announcements or is there a way to do this through the plugin?

    Is there a walk through of how to set this up? I searched but can't find anything specific on the forums.

    Also, i see there is the sonoscontroller plugin and then also sonos scripts, what is the difference between these, and which would be better for this application?

    Not sure about the Play 1's compatibility because I only have 3's and 5's but you can do TTS through the plug-in without any line in, with both the HS2 and HS3 versions of the plug-in. This is how I'm doing it. Basically, speech is sent to a file and this is then played over Sonos.

    Instructions on how to set it up are in the help file once you have the plug-in installed.

    There is a slight delay in the announcements being heard which increases the more players you have in your TTS groups but I can live with this. I'm very happy with the way it works and Dirk provides excellent support for the plug-in.

          Open the HS3 webpage, click Tools > Help > Sonos Help
